- 30 Apr, 2023 3 commits
-
-
Vitaly Lipatov authored
- epm play: fix bitwarden, wpsoffice, trueconf - epm: add Requires: update-kernel for ALT - distr_info: allow override distr via DISTRNAMEOVERRIDE or latest arg - epm play: rewrite IPFS DB download, check epm specific version URL - epm play common.sh: update to latest available version in any case - epm repack trueconf: use requires from the original package - epm repack trueconf-server: improve preinstall packages - epm repack: drop old libicu in requires - eget: add support for UTF-8 filename in Content-disposition - epm: change CMDSHELL to /usr/bin/env bash and use CMDSHELL for call scripts
-
Vitaly Lipatov authored
-
Vitaly Lipatov authored
- epm play brave: fix download - epm play anydesk: fix version - epm play: add bitwarden - epm play: add unityhub - epm repo addkey: fix download key - epm pack 1c83-client: fix unpacking, use erc - epm play: add --remove all support - eget: fix for brave go-ipfs - epm repo addkey: allow key name as first arg - epm status: add --installable - epm play angie: use new order for epm repo addkey - epm play: enable whatsapp support for other distro - epm repack vk-calls: add /etc/tmpfiles.d/vk-calls.conf - emp-sh-functions: set TMPDIR if missed - epm repack: run repack scripts with buildroot dir as current dir - epm: add unknown options to pkg_options - epm: improve args separating - for extra repos use eget, not rsync - rewrite tmp file cleaning - distr_info: resort functions - optimization: use eval distr_info --print-eepm-env instead of separated calls - use /usr/bin/env bash shebang
-
- 26 Apr, 2023 2 commits
-
-
Vitaly Lipatov authored
- epm play: fix synology-chat - epm play: add youtube-music - epm play: add angie support - epm play/pack: add install some Pantum drivers - epm play brave: rewrite - epm pack: improve working with tmpdir, simplify - epm fatal/warning: colorify only key word - epm repo add: add Alpine support - epm repo addkey: add Alpine support - epm repo addkey: add dnf/yum support - epm repo addkey: improve ALT support - epm pack.d/common.sh: add exit to return_tar() - epm play: fix version as second arg - epm play wine: fix install with --only-i586 - epm upgrade: pass -V when --verbose (for apt based systems) - epm install: improve --noscripts workaround - epm-sh-functions erc(): install p7zip in any case
-
Vitaly Lipatov authored
- epm play: add yaradio-yamusic - epm play: add lycheeslicer support - epm: use bash directly - serv: add all initial detection, use bash directly - epm play: add libicu56 (for ALT only) - epm repack trueconf: update script - epm play.d/common.sh: fix PKGNAME detection - epm repack synology-drive: ignore if removed extra files is missed - epm play: fix download name in various scripts - epm play: update synology* scripts - eepm.spec: drop BR: rpm-build-intro (isn't used anymore)
-
- 25 Apr, 2023 2 commits
-
-
Vitaly Lipatov authored
-
Vitaly Lipatov authored
- epm repack microsoft-edge: use one file, add conflicts - epm play: update IPFS DB every time (and merge with sort) - epm status: add --validate (check for package correctness) - epm play: add check for origin of install repo for all targets - epm play: fix --force handling - fatal(): add epm version to error message - epm status --original: don't check Signature field - epm autoorphans: don't call epm remove without packages - pkgallowscripts.list: add lsb-cprocsp exclude - i586-fix.sh: comment out NetworkManager-libnm - make epm update-kernel no fatal on apt systems - epm play: rewrite to support set version where possible - rewrite check for package vendor and package source
-
- 24 Apr, 2023 1 commit
-
-
Vitaly Lipatov authored
- makefile: drop bashisms - epm restore: add meson.build support - epm-sh-functions: set_sudo: improve sudo checking - epm play zerotier-one: get latest version from the site - implement epm status [--installed|--original|--thirdpart|--repacked] - epm repack: save repacked packages with epm release - epm-sh-functions: __epm_check_if_package_from_repo(): add check for empty Signature field - epm play: check already installed package with is_repacked_package (implemented via epm status) - epm play: add pencil support
-
- 22 Apr, 2023 8 commits
-
-
Vitaly Lipatov authored
- makefile: fix install play.d
-
Vitaly Lipatov authored
- tools_json: replace egrep with grep -E - eget: add -H (--header) support - epm play icq: get latest version from snapcraft.io - distr_info: fix Manjaro support - epm ei: use --auto in pipe mode - generic-appimage.sh: use cd & run (some progs runs only relative to current dir) - epm play: add clibgrab - eepm.spec: move install code to Makefile - eepm.spec: update Source URL - remove yum subpackage (will pack separately)
-
Vitaly Lipatov authored
-
Vitaly Lipatov authored
-
Vitaly Lipatov authored
-
Vitaly Lipatov authored
-
Vitaly Lipatov authored
-
Vitaly Lipatov authored
-
- 21 Apr, 2023 3 commits
-
-
Vitaly Lipatov authored
- epm play: add cnrdrvcups-ufr2 support - epm repo add/remove: add korinf support - erc-sh-archive: add diag message if backend is missed - erc-sh-archive: add checking for 7zr and 7zz - epm-sh-functions erc(): check if some erc backend is installed and install p7zip if missed - epm-repack: add p7zip require - allow EPM_BACKEND and SERV_BACKEND to force backend to use - epm-release_upgrade: remove apt-conf-sisyphus only if installed
-
Vitaly Lipatov authored
-
Vitaly Lipatov authored
- epm repack aksusbd: create empty /etc/hasplm/nethasp.ini (ALT bug 44480) - epm play: net.downloadhelper.coapp - epm print: fix: check if file is real package - epm update: check for new Korinf version not with eepm from stable ALT branches - epm ei: do nothing on stable ALT branches
-
- 19 Apr, 2023 1 commit
-
-
Vitaly Lipatov authored
- epm play: add lithium support - epm play: add aksusbd - epm play cascadeur: get build-id and version from the site - epm repack: install packages only on ALT - epm repack softmaker-freeoffice-2021: fix - epm install: ignore /home dir as possible bin dir - eget: restore missed quotes after href
-
- 18 Apr, 2023 1 commit
-
-
Vitaly Lipatov authored
- distr_info: print empty package type if unknown - distr_info: add NixOS support - epm repack kubo: fix conflicts - epm play codium: check if the package is already installed from repo - epm play chromium-gost and yandex-browser: fix checking for the package from repo - epm: add some nix support - epm pack: add support for version as third arg - epm play: add initial support for cascadeur
-
- 17 Apr, 2023 1 commit
-
-
Vitaly Lipatov authored
- epm-sh_functions: add colors to fatal() and warning() - epm install: add warning when install third-party software - rename chocolatey -> choco - eget: improve globbing symbol translation - epm play: add kubo support - epm install: redirect install by path (/usr/bin/git) to install via hi-level commands for all distro - epm play: add sane-panakvs (Panasonic Scanner Driver for Linux) - epm play: add print out for all epm commands - epm play okular-csp: some improvements - epm print contructname: improve delimiter issue - epm play: fix URLs with fixed eget wildcards - eget: disable checking for magic CID if IPFS is used - eget: check Brave IPFS after local ipfs in IPFS auto mode
-
- 15 Apr, 2023 2 commits
-
-
Vitaly Lipatov authored
- epm play: add zerotier-one - epm: fix warmup issue again - epm: fix query-package, query (fix epm_package param using)
-
Vitaly Lipatov authored
- epm play: fix shift when --ipfs - eget: don't return put error in gateway mode
-
- 14 Apr, 2023 1 commit
-
-
Vitaly Lipatov authored
- distr_info: add missed fields for old ALT distro - epm repack: add support for remotedesktopmanager - epm repack.d/generic-appimage.sh: use correct icon name - epm repack.d/generic-appimage.sh: add alternative link too - epm repack.d/generic-appimage.sh: install /usr/share/icons/hicolor... if exists - epm repack.d/common-chromium-browser.sh: add add_deps() - epm repack.d/generic-appimage.sh: add predefined deps for electron based apps - epm play: add todoist support - epm repack.d/common-chromium-browser.sh: install/add deps only on ALT - eget: fix get real url again - epm-autoremove: force mark sudo as manual (some bug in a distro?) - epm prescription i586-fix.sh: add libnm (needed for Steam) - add support for termux-pkg - epm search: use direct args - epm: implement list-available - epm packages: use direct args - drop epm list, epm -l aliases for epm packages - epm: implement list (with --available and --installed options) - epm: improve winget support - epm play: refactoring - epm: add --disable-interactivity alias for --non-interactive - epm ei: add special case for eepm install - eget: fix embedded mode
-
- 12 Apr, 2023 1 commit
-
-
Vitaly Lipatov authored
- eget: fix --check - eget: add filename support in ipfs://Qm...filename=real.name - epm play unigine: fix name producing, fix url - eget: hide IPFS mode status when IPFS mode is disabled - eget: fix quiet mode, add --quiet alias for -q
-
- 11 Apr, 2023 1 commit
-
-
Vitaly Lipatov authored
- epm tool: add which command - play/repack/pack common.sh: use epm tool which for is_command - ungoogled-chromium: fix sandbox - epm play: add --ipfs support - epm install: fix --replacepkgs again - epm repack: fix warning when we have repacking rule - epm ei: fix checking for interactive mode - epm repack vinteo.desktop: fix repacking on ALT/p9 - epm-update: fix checking for new eepm package - epm play --ipfs: initialize db with site prepared data - distr_info: don't use GNU sed extension - epm: add EPMMODE: package, single, pipe, git - epm repack: use EPM <support@eepm.ru> packager and skip warning if a package packaged by one - epm play unigine*: skip temp dir - epm: improve AlpineLinux support - epm: add stats command - epm play okular: improve message about CryptoPro - eget: big rewrite to support IPFS mode (EGET_IPFS=disabled,auto,brave,local,gateway) - eget: add EGET_IPFS_DB file support (save after download, get when download) - eget: add --get-filename, --get-real-url, --get-response, --get-ipfs-cid - eget: use scat only for get remote content - eget: refactoring wget/curl detection - eget: add support for EGET_BACKEND=curl,wget - eget: add hack to get headers ever if HEAD is not allowed - eget: stop recursion with EGET_ vars
-
- 09 Apr, 2023 1 commit
-
-
Vitaly Lipatov authored
- epm play trueconf: fix libicu require - epm ei: get real path before epm install (to fix ask about install) - epm play: add mobirise, lunacy, ungoogled-chromium - epm: drop less using - epm play sweethome3d: support for latest version, rewrite repack
-
- 07 Apr, 2023 1 commit
-
-
Vitaly Lipatov authored
- serv: use is_command instead of direct which - serv: use service type detection from epm print info --service-manager - distr_info: use hascommand instead of direct which - distr_info: add long option --service-manager, fix print info formatting - distr_info: fix distro-version for ROSAFresh - distr_info: fix reponame for ALTServer - distr_info: return from ROSAFresh to ROSA
-
- 06 Apr, 2023 1 commit
-
-
Vitaly Lipatov authored
- epm play master-pdf-editor: fix download url - distr_info: vendor rosafresh for ROSAFresh - epm repack common.sh: implement file path support in filter_from_requires - epm release-upgrade: fix syntax error
-
- 05 Apr, 2023 1 commit
-
-
Vitaly Lipatov authored
- remove direct which command using - epm repack.d/example.sh: improve example - repack.d/softmaker-freeoffice-2012.sh: don't use erc directly - repack.d/portproton.sh: add some missed requires (gawk, tar, /usr/bin/convert) - add compatibility layer (print_command_path, is_command, subst) to pack.d and repack.d - epm pack/play/repack: add warning about .rpmnew files - epm repack rustdesk.sh: fix for build nightly release - epm history: print rpm sessions too - epm download: fix for download several packages - epm addrepo: add support for c9f* - epm repo: add create command (epm repo index --init) - epm repo comment: remove in favour epm repo disable - epm play portproton: get latest release from github, not fixed version - distr_info: print correct version for c9f* - distr_info fix support for ROSAFresh
-
- 03 Apr, 2023 4 commits
-
-
Vitaly Lipatov authored
-
Vitaly Lipatov authored
-
Vitaly Lipatov authored
-
Vitaly Lipatov authored
- epm play: add DVJ2 - epm.spec: require bash instead of sh
-
- 01 Apr, 2023 1 commit
-
-
Vitaly Lipatov authored
-
- 31 Mar, 2023 1 commit
-
-
Vitaly Lipatov authored
- epm play: add alivecolors support - epm play: add freeoffice - epm addrepo: add astra repos with [arch-=i386] - erc: use 7z if patool is missed - erc: add --use-7z and --use-patool - add prepare_to_eepm.sh - eget: improve is_url checking - eget: disable checking for globbing symbol ? in URL - epm: add -y as --auto alias - epm: print short help when run without params - epm prescription: add i586-support - epm install: don't use --replacepkgs when install only one package - epm prescription: add nvidia-remove - epm: add --norepack option - epm pack: rewrite - epm repack: move repack stoplist to /etc/eepm/repackstoplist.list - epm repack generic.sh: skip links - epm release-upgrade: print info about ALT wiki when update to ALT Sisyphus
-
- 30 Mar, 2023 1 commit
-
-
Vitaly Lipatov authored
- eget: make correct URL if file part parsed by mask separately - epm play: add vuescan - epm play: fix download url for anydesk (according to latest eget) - epm play: add cuda-z support - eget: big rewrite - epm play: add netbeans - epm ei: add help, rewrite parsing - epm ei: add support to set Korinf URL - epm addrepo: add support for AstraLinux
-
- 29 Mar, 2023 1 commit
-
-
Vitaly Lipatov authored
- epm ei: add fallback to vendor/repo dir - distr_info: print bug report url - distr_info: add default repo name (the same like distro version) - epm download: use eget --latest if mask is not *.something - epm: allow --dry-run for kernel-update/remove-old-kernels - epm full-upgrade: skip snap if snap service is not running (ALT bug 45666) - epm install: add --download-only support for repository packages (via epm download) - epm download: implement package download for ALT via apt-get install --print-uris - add epm download --url for apt-rpm and apt-dpkg systems
-
- 27 Mar, 2023 1 commit
-
-
Vitaly Lipatov authored
- distr_info: add --repo-name, --distro-name, --base-distro-name - distr_info: add full version for Astra - distr_info: add long options, rearrange default output
-